Does Dr. Chiles treat patients with recurrent kidney stones?
Recurrent kidney stones are a common reason patients seek urological care, and Dr. Chiles can evaluate the underlying causes through imaging and metabolic testing. Treatment may include dietary guidance, medication, or procedural intervention depending on stone type and frequency.
